Japanese Bronze and Champ Leve Censer
About the Item
Japanese bronze and champleve censer jar. Large elephant handles and a standing elephant finial on the top lid. Six hexagonal sides. Bronze with fine details ground in the archaic style. The enamel ground with an elaborate scene of dragons, demons and flaming pearls. Dark aged patina, circa 1900.

- Suit of Red Lacquer Japanese Fighting Armor of the Late Edo PeriodLocated in San Francisco, CASuit of red lacquer Japanese fighting armour of the late Edo period, (1716-1868). Desirable coral red lacquer is original and unrestored. Composed of a helmet, (Kabuto) breast plate (Do) and shoulder, arm protection (chainmail). Displayed with a later recreation expressive face plate of modern manufacture (nose, mustache). Also displayed with (photos 3 & 4) a period red lacquer partial face plate (Hambo) with replacement throat guards. All of the assembled parts are of same age, quality and color.
